My "Service Stabil Trac" light has come on twice in the past month. On both occassions, it went out after re-starting the vehicle. I spoke to the dealer and was told the light has to be on for a diagnoses of the problem. Even though the light is now off, I'm taking it in to the dealer. Does anyone know what some common problems are, the fix, and what's involved with the "service"?

I don't know if this applies, however I have similar problem with my 2006 Trailblazer with Stabilitrak. It was determined on those vehicles that sometimes during cold weather (less than 50 with my truck), if you park the front wheels at an angle, the sensors in the front wheels will not have a good connection upon startup, and will report a fault. If the wheels are parked straight, the system should be fine. I've noticed that as soon as I start moving, if the light comes on, I stop the car, restart it, and then keep going. The light should be off by then. Its just become habit to remember to park the car with the wheels straight and I usually don't have to worry about it. Hope this helps!

I agree w/ deuce, we had this happen last month, several subzero days and my wife was called off work because of the weather so the EQ sat through those days. When she went back to work, on the way home she receive the "Service Stabil Trac" and lost power steering! The next morning everything was fine. Not sure how the wheels were but with a few days of snow and -4 to -12 days and the EQ not moving, I can see weather being the cause of this.
